| Term | extrasynaptic signaling via GABA | ID (Ontology) | GO:0160001 (Gene Ontology) |
| Definition | Cell-cell signaling that starts with the activation of extrasynaptic GABA receptors in neurons through binding of ambient gamma-aminobutyric acid present in the extracellular fluid.[ PubMed:23038269 PubMed:9364051 ] | ||
